Structure and How It Works

These worksheets typically feature a grid or drawing divided into sections, each containing a simple addition or subtraction problem. Core Exercises: The user must solve the arithmetic problem within each section. The answer to each problem corresponds to a specific color key provided on the worksheet. Once the solution is found, the corresponding section is colored in with the indicated color. Interactive Elements: The progressive reveal of the image as the problems are solved adds an element of suspense and anticipation. This format encourages careful calculation and attention to detail. Worksheets often vary in complexity, catering to different skill levels. Some sheets may focus solely on addition, while others may focus solely on subtraction, and some sheets combine both operations. The designs themselves range from simple geometric patterns to more complex images of animals, objects, or scenes, catering to a variety of interests. Tips and Complementary Resources

To maximize the benefits of these worksheets, it is helpful to start with simpler sheets focusing on single-digit addition and subtraction. Daily Practice Tips: Encourage children to check their answers before coloring in each section to prevent errors and reinforce accuracy. Introducing the worksheets in short, focused sessions can help maintain engagement. Providing a variety of coloring tools, such as crayons, colored pencils, or markers, can add to the enjoyment of the activity. Pairing with Other Resources: To further support learning, these worksheets can be supplemented with other mathematical resources such as flashcards, online games, or manipulatives.
